Many educators are familiar with the term Universal Design for Learning (UDL) and want to know more about how to use this framework to create engaging and dynamic lessons for all students. Join me to explore what UDL is and is not, and how it can be used to create accessible learning experiences for your students. Participants will modify an existing lesson during our workshop. Please bring a lesson that you would like to adjust and refine with UDL principles. Several take away resources will be shared!
